• インフラジスティックス・ジャパン株式会社: 050 (1745) 6258
  • マイアカウント
Infragistics Infragistics
メニュー
  • マイ アカウント
    • ログイン
  • 開発
    • おすすめパッケージ
      Infragistics Ultimate¥260,000
      (税抜)
      Web、モバイル、デスクトップアプリ構築のためのUX / UIツールキット完全版
      Infragistics Professional ¥180,000​
      (税抜)
      Web、モバイル、デスクトップ開発者向けの包括的なUIコンポーネントライブラリ
      Ignite UI¥160,000
      (税抜)
      Webアプリを構築するためのUIコンポーネント完全版ライブラリ
    • WEB向け
      App Builder(New) Ignite UI Angular Blazor React Web Components Ultimate UI ASP.NET Core Ultimate UI ASP.NET MVC Ultimate UI jQuery Ultimate UI for ASP.NET Web Forms
    • デスクトップ向け
      Ultimate UI for Windows FormsUltimate UI for WPF
      クロスプラットフォーム向け
      Ultimate UI for Uno Ultimate UI for UWP Ultimate UI for WinUI Ultimate UI for Xamarin
    • Design to Code
      App Builder(New)Indigo.Design UIキット
      初めてご利用の方
      会社・製品概要のご紹介
  • UX
    • App Builderドラッグアンドドロップで Web アプリケーションを構築できる ローコード デザインツール
  • BIツール
    • Reveal様々なプラットフォームで簡単にダッシュボード作成やデータ可視化が可能な、組み込み型データ分析ツール
    • Slingshotデータ、プロジェクト管理、コンテンツ、チャット。チームの可能性を最大限に引き出すタスク・プロジェクト管理ツール
  • サービス
    • サービスとサポートご利用ニーズに合わせたサービス・サポートメニューをご用意しております。
    • 有償技術支援UX/UIや開発についての各種有償技術支援サービスをご提供しております。
    • React入門
      オンデマンド技術トレーニング(New)Reactトレーニング入門編 基礎からライブラリ導入まで学べます。
    • WPF入門
      オンデマンド技術トレーニングWPFを利用した Windows アプリケーション開発を新たに行う場合に最適なトレーニングです。
  • リソース
    • 製品ヘルプ
    • ナレッジベース
    • サンプルアプリケーション
    • お客様導入事例
    • ウェビナー
    • オンデマンド動画
    • ホワイトペーパー
    • ブログ
  • ご購入
    • ご購入ガイド
    • プランと価格
    • サポート環境
    • サポートポリシー
    • サブスクリプションとは
    • サブスクリプション更新
    • 販売パートナー
    • 法的情報
    • FAQ
  • 資料請求
  • 無料トライアル
  • お問い合わせ
 
Windows Forms | Controls
  • Download Trial
Your Privacy Matters: We use our own and third-party cookies to improve your experience on our website. By continuing to use the website we understand that you accept their use. Cookie Policy
OK
お客様のプライバシーに関する事項
当社では、Webサイトでのお客様の利便性を向上させるために、自社およびサードパーティのクッキーを使用しています。また、これらのクッキーを使用することで、ユーザーの行動を分析し、継続的にWebサイトを改善することができます。下記のCookieポリシーとCookie設定をご確認ください。
設定の管理 OK
プライバシー設定
Webサイトを訪問すると、ブラウザに情報が保存または取得されることがあります。この情報は、お客様、お客様の好み、またはお客様のデバイスに関するもので、ほとんどの場合、お客様が期待するようにサイトを動作させるために使用されます。この情報は通常、お客様を直接特定するものではありませんが、よりパーソナライズされたWeb体験を提供することができます。当社はお客様のプライバシーの権利を尊重するため、一部の種類のCookieを許可しないよう選択することができます。ただし、一部の種類のCookieをブロックすると、サイトの利用や提供できるサービスに影響を与える可能性があります。
すべて受け入れる
ログインデータと優れたサイトパフォーマンスのために必要なCookie
Webサイトの機能や特徴をサポートするCookie
Cookie は、当社のサードパーティの広告パートナーによって提供され、お客様の閲覧習慣に関する情報を収集します
Cookieは、広告メッセージをお客様やお客様の関心により適したものにするために使用されます
すべて拒否 選択内容を確認
  • Grids & Lists
    • Grid
    • List View
    • Pivot Grid
    • Spreadsheet
    • Tree List
  • Charts
    • Category Chart
    • Chart
    • Data Chart
    • Doughnut Chart
    • Funnel Chart
    • Pie Chart
    • Sparkline
  • Barcodes
    • Barcode
  • Data Entry & Display
    • Color Picker
    • Combo Box Editor
    • Editors
    • Extras
    • Form Manager
    • Spell Checker
    • Ultra Radio Button
  • Data Visualizations
    • Gantt View
    • Geographic Map
  • Frameworks
    • Calculation Manager
    • Data Source
    • Documents Framework
    • Excel Exporter
    • Excel Library
    • Flat Data Source
    • Grid Document Exporter
    • Math Library
    • Syntax Parsing Engine
    • Word Framework
    • Word Exporter
  • Gauges
    • Bullet Graph
    • Gauge
    • Linear Gauge
  • Interactions
    • Desktop Alert
    • Printing
    • Peek Pop-up
  • Layouts
    • Carousel
    • Dock Manager
    • Grid Bag Layout Panel
    • Group Box
    • Layout Managers
    • Live Tile View
    • Message Box Manager
    • Panel
    • Splitter
    • Tab
    • Tabbed MDI
    • Tile Panel
    • Zoom Panel
  • Menus
    • Explorer Bar
    • Navigation Bar
    • Notification Badges
    • Office Nav Bar
    • Radial Menu
    • Ribbon Customization
    • Toolbars
  • Scheduling
    • Schedule
  • Styling & Themes
    • AppStylist
WinForms Syntax Parsing Engine

Windows Forms Syntax Parsing Engine

The Syntax Parsing Engine processes text and devises (based on the rules of the grammar provided to the engine) tokens that have meaning for syntax analysis processes. It includes find and replace functionality, error reporting, document navigation, and more. The Syntax Parsing Engine fully supports EBNF-based language and can parse it into proper tokens, keywords, and constructs.

Download Windows Forms Samples

WinForms Lexing/Parsing

Lexing/Parsing

The Syntax Parsing Engine processes text and creates meaningful tokens based on the rules of the grammar provided to the engine. The tokens generated by the lexing process are then used to apply syntax analysis to the document text based on the language specified. The parser is a high performance engine that works for both deterministic and non-deterministic (i.e. ambiguous) grammars.


WinForms Document Searching

Document Searching

The Syntax Parsing Engine provides the ability to search a document for instances of text that match search criteria using methods like Find, Find and Replace, Find All, and Find and Replace All. Specify how to perform the search by providing the direction (forward or backward), case sensitivity, whole word or partial word, the text to find, or a regex pattern.


Syntax Tree/Error Reporting

Expose a syntax tree of the text document, which represents the syntactic structure of the text rules of the language provided to the engine. The syntax tree marks invalid nodes as errors and they can be accessed (down to a given character range) using methods exposed by the API.

WinForms Syntax Tree/Error Reporting

Document Navigation

Scan through lines, tokens, and words with a simple API. Go to the start or end of a document, go to a specific line, token, or word. Find where you are in a document and continue to examine the previous or next tokens or words without changing the current position.

WinForms Document Navigation

EBNF Support

Just feed in a language’s EBNF and the syntax library can parse it through and recognize the keywords, tokens, and language construct from it. The plain text, C#, and VB languages are supported out of the box. Fully supports ISO EBNF notation (ISO-14977:1996(E)).

WinForms EBNF Support
  • 製品
    • 初めての方へ
    • 開発ツール
    • UXツール
    • データ可視化
    • コラボレーション
    • 無料トライアル
  • 購入について
    • ご購入ガイド
    • プランと価格
    • サブスクリプションとは
    • 販売パートナー
    • FAQ
  • ラーニング
    • ヘルプとAPIドキュメント
    • ナレッジベース
    • サンプルアプリケーション
    • ウェビナー
  • サポート
    • 製品ライフサイクル
    • サービスリリース情報
    • サポート環境
    • サポートポリシー
    • テクニカルサポートチャット
    • サービスヘルスダッシュボード
  • マイアカウント
    • サブスクリプションの管理
    • サポートアクティビティ
    • サポート要求の送信
  • 他社製品との比較
    • Ignite UI for Angular
  • 会社情報
    • 会社概要
    • ニュース
    • 採用情報
    • 法的情報
    • 提携パートナー
    • パートナープログラムへのお申し込み
メールマガジンのご案内

テクノロジーや弊社製品に関する最新情報、イベントやキャンペーン情報をお届けします!

購読する
  • プライバシーポリシー
  • クッキーポリシー
  • 利用条件
  • 特定商取引法に基づく表記
I.S. Partners SOC2 SEAL GDPR SEAL
© Copyright 2025 INFRAGISTICS. All Rights Reserved
Back to top of page